Navigating anxiety or depression alone can be overwhelming. LIFELINE Support Groups are peer-led communities of individuals working on their mental health, providing a safe space to share, listen, and heal together.
LIFELINE Support Groups aim to stand in the gap for individuals navigating what can be a lonely and painful journey by providing safe spaces for them to share their stories and receive support. LIFELINE is not therapy; rather, a support system that is freely available to anyone struggling with anxiety and/or depression who simply needs to feel less alone.
